If you stretch the slide out longer on a trombone, the note played will be:
A
lower pitched
B
higher pitched
C
louder
D
softer
Explanation: 

Detailed explanation-1: -It is possible to increase the pitch even as you extend the slide. In general, the longer the tube, the lower the note. However, trombone players can play higher notes as they extend the slide, simply by closing their mouths and changing how they blow into the instrument.

Detailed explanation-2: -By doing so, pulling the slide out will lengthen the tubing so the instrument will sound lower while pushing it in makes the tubing shorter, thus resulting in a sharper pitch.

Detailed explanation-3: -The player makes this column of air vibrate by buzzing the lips while blowing air through a cup or funnel shaped mouthpiece. To produce higher or lower pitches, the player adjusts the opening between his/her lips.

Detailed explanation-4: -The F-attachment on the trombone has two main purposes: It provides alternate slide positions for some notes. It provides a few lower notes. (It can also allow certain trills, but this is an advanced use).
